Michael Page are partnering with a global manufacturing organisation to recruit a Part-Time HR Business Partner / Advisor in a newly evolving UK HR function. This is a fantastic opportunity to join a business undergoing positive transformation following international integration, offering meaningful, hands-on HR exposure in a collaborative environment.

With a UK workforce of around 70 employees and a wider global presence, the organisation is continuing to embed its structure and processes. This role will play a key part in shaping and delivering effective HR operations locally, while staying aligned with a central European HR team.

This opportunity is particularly well suited to individuals seeking a flexible working arrangement, whether balancing other commitments or looking to transition into a part-time role without compromising on impact or responsibility.

This is a highly operational, hands-on HR role with a strong focus on transactional and day-to-day HR activities. You will act as the primary HR contact for the UK site, supporting both employees and leadership while collaborating with the wider international HR function.

You will be based primarily in Trafford Park, with regular travel to a second site in Lancashire.

Key Responsibilities

Managing day-to-day HR operations across the UK site
Supporting employee relations activity and case management
Coordinating recruitment processes and onboarding
Administering HR documentation and maintaining employee records
Coordinating mandatory training and development activities
Liaising with an external payroll provider, including submission of monthly changes
Supporting salary review processes
Reviewing and updating HR policies to ensure compliance with UK legislation and alignment with group standards
